態(tài)與當前的主備捆綁組工作狀態(tài)相同,保持主備捆綁組狀態(tài)不變,繼續(xù)在主用捆綁組上進行流量轉發(fā),周期性執(zhí)行上述步驟;若比較確認本端為備且選舉結果字段解析為1,則執(zhí)行保護倒換,主備捆綁組進行保護倒換,將備用捆綁組設置為當前的主用捆綁組,將主用捆綁組設置為當前的備用捆綁組,倒換后的主用捆綁組進行流量轉發(fā),周期性執(zhí)行上述步驟;若本端確認的結果與對端返回的選舉結果并不一致,即比較確認本端為主且選舉結果字段為1,或者比較確認本端為備且選舉結果字段為0,則再次發(fā)送主備協(xié)商報文,如果連續(xù)三次協(xié)商結果都有異議,則執(zhí)行強制倒換;
[0067]當主用捆綁組中有成員鏈路發(fā)生故障時,主用捆綁組收到故障通告事件,重新計算本端的選舉字段,進行主備協(xié)商;
[0068]在協(xié)商過程中使用的主備選舉規(guī)則按照優(yōu)先級由高及低主要包括以下五個方面:
(I)判斷主備捆綁組的激活狀態(tài)字段是否都為激活態(tài),如果不是,則主備捆綁組中,處于激活狀態(tài)的鏈路捆綁組的優(yōu)先級高于處于非激活狀態(tài)的鏈路捆綁組的優(yōu)先級;(2)比較主備捆綁組的激活鏈路總帶寬,如果不相等,則主備捆綁組中,激活鏈路總帶寬較高的捆綁組的優(yōu)先級高于激活鏈路總帶寬較低的捆綁組的優(yōu)先級;(3)比較主備捆綁組的系統(tǒng)優(yōu)先級,如果不相等,則主備捆綁組中,系統(tǒng)優(yōu)先級較高的捆綁組的優(yōu)先級高于系統(tǒng)優(yōu)先級較低的捆綁組的優(yōu)先級;(4)比較主備捆綁組中處于激活狀態(tài)的成員端口的個數,如果不相等,則主備捆綁組中,激活成員端口個數較多的捆綁組的優(yōu)先級高于激活成員端口個數較低的捆綁組的優(yōu)先級;(5)以上策略均判別不出高低,則主備捆綁組的優(yōu)先級相等,當前的主用捆綁組定為主用捆綁組。
[0069]在實際應用中,參照圖3,本步驟包括:
[0070]RouterU Router2開啟主備協(xié)商,在PoS7_PoS8通道?;罴せ詈?,PoS7立刻開始定期發(fā)送協(xié)商報文。協(xié)商報文除了攜帶PoS7的端口基礎數據以外,還附上本端捆綁組Pg3的標號,本端系統(tǒng)優(yōu)先級,Pg3的最小鏈路激活門限,Pg3的鏈路總帶寬,Pg3的當前激活狀態(tài);
[0071]PoS8收到PoS7發(fā)來的協(xié)商報文并解析,按照主備選舉規(guī)則,將解析出來的對端BDl的選舉字段和本設備BD2的相應字段逐一進行比較,比較激活狀態(tài),兩端均為激活態(tài);比較捆綁組帶寬,發(fā)現BDl的三條激活鏈路帶寬總和大于BD2的三條激活鏈路帶寬和,由此確認當前的主用鏈路捆綁組BDl選舉為主用鏈路捆綁組,BD2為備用鏈路捆綁組;PoS8設置選舉結果字段為0,并連同本端口的基礎數據和BD2的選舉字段一同組包,返回給PoS7進行協(xié)商應答。PoS7收到對端發(fā)送的應答報文,解析對端的選舉字段,與本端的選舉字段作比較,確認本端BDl的三條激活鏈路帶寬總和大于對端BD2的三條激活鏈路帶寬和,于是確定本端為協(xié)商出來的主用鏈路捆綁組,此結果與解析出的對端給出的選舉結果字段O —致,確認結果有效,即BDl為主用鏈路捆綁組,BD2為備用鏈路捆綁組,保持當前的主備鏈路捆綁組工作狀態(tài)不變,繼續(xù)進行流量轉發(fā)。定時器到再次發(fā)送協(xié)商報文進行協(xié)商;
[0072]本發(fā)明中使用的建鏈報文、?;顖笪暮蛥f(xié)商報文格式,采用對標準HDLC報文格式的信息字段進行擴展,將其擴充為Protocol code+Pdu tyPe+Data的組合,具體結構如圖5所示,其中需要說明的是:
[0073]Address,該字段填 0x8F ;
[0074]Control,該字段填 0x00 ;
[0075]Protocol code,該字段填 0x8035 ;
[0076]Pdu type,該字段填充報文類型,具體如圖5所示;
[0077]Data,用于承載要發(fā)送的信息,具體采用t Iv格式,即type+lenght+value的格式,type表示TLV的類型,length是以字節(jié)為單位的TLV的長度,value是該TLV的值。本發(fā)明需要攜帶的tlv類型信息如圖5所示。
[0078]S404:接入設備利用主鏈路捆綁組進行數據轉發(fā)。
[0079]綜上可知,通過本發(fā)明的實施,至少存在以下有益效果:
[0080]為同一接入設備分配多個匯聚設備,并分別鏈路捆綁組,使得接入設備可以通過多個鏈路捆綁組/匯聚設備與網絡服務器連接,并且根據鏈路捆綁組信息來確定主備鏈路捆綁組,在此基礎上,正常情況下,接入設備通過主鏈路捆綁組完成數據轉發(fā),當主鏈路捆綁組或者所連接的匯聚設備故障時,通過主備倒換完成鏈路捆綁組的倒換,這樣接入設備就可以保持業(yè)務的正常運行,解決了現有技術存在的當鏈路捆綁組/匯聚設備故障所導致業(yè)務中斷的問題。
[0081]以上僅是本發(fā)明的【具體實施方式】而已,并非對本發(fā)明做任何形式上的限制,凡是依據本發(fā)明的技術實質對以上實施方式所做的任意簡單修改、等同變化、結合或修飾,均仍屬于本發(fā)明技術方案的保護范圍。
【主權項】
1.一種鏈路捆綁方法,其特征在于,包括: 為接入設備分配至少兩個匯聚設備; 接入設備與匯聚設備建立鏈路捆綁組; 匯聚設備交互鏈路捆綁組信息,根據所述鏈路捆綁組信息確定主鏈路捆綁組及備鏈路捆綁組。2.如權利要求1所述的鏈路捆綁方法,其特征在于,所述接入設備與匯聚設備建立鏈路捆綁組的步驟包括:所述接入設備與所述匯聚設備確定鏈路捆綁組的成員鏈路,各成員鏈路激活組建鏈路捆綁組。3.如權利要求2所述的鏈路捆綁方法,其特征在于,還包括:檢測成員鏈路是否處于激活狀態(tài),當處于激活狀態(tài)的成員鏈路大于激活數量閾值時,將鏈路捆綁組設置為激活狀態(tài)。4.如權利要求1至3任一項所述的鏈路捆綁方法,其特征在于,所述匯聚設備交互鏈路捆綁組信息的方式包括:所述匯聚設備獲取其與所述接入設備之間的鏈路捆綁組的鏈路捆綁組信息,并發(fā)送至為同一接入設備分配的其他匯聚設備;所述根據所述鏈路捆綁組信息確定主鏈路捆綁組的步驟包括:匯聚設備將接收到的鏈路捆綁組信息與其自身獲取的鏈路捆綁組信息比對,根據比對結果從至少兩個鏈路捆綁組內選取一個作為主鏈路捆綁組。5.如權利要求4所述的鏈路捆綁方法,其特征在于,所述鏈路捆綁組信息包括鏈路捆綁組的識別參數、激活狀態(tài)及捆綁組帶寬。6.如權利要求4所述的鏈路捆綁方法,其特征在于,還包括:周期性交互鏈路捆綁組信息的步驟;當確定的主鏈路捆綁組與前次確定的主鏈路捆綁組不一致時,執(zhí)行主備鏈路捆綁組的倒換。7.一種鏈路捆綁系統(tǒng),其特征在于,包括接入設備、匯聚設備及分配裝置,其中, 所述分配裝置用于為接入設備分配至少兩個匯聚設備; 所述匯聚設備用于與接入設備建立鏈路捆綁組,交互鏈路捆綁組信息,根據所述鏈路捆綁組信息確定主鏈路捆綁組及備鏈路捆綁組。8.如權利要求7所述的鏈路捆綁系統(tǒng),其特征在于,所述匯聚設備還用于獲取其與所述接入設備之間的鏈路捆綁組的鏈路捆綁組信息,并發(fā)送至為同一接入設備分配的其他匯聚設備,將接收到的鏈路捆綁組信息與其自身獲取的鏈路捆綁組信息比對,根據比對結果從至少兩個鏈路捆綁組內選取一個作為主鏈路捆綁組。9.如權利要求8所述的鏈路捆綁系統(tǒng),其特征在于,所述鏈路捆綁組信息包括鏈路捆綁組的識別參數、激活狀態(tài)及捆綁組帶寬。10.如權利要求7至9任一項所述的鏈路捆綁系統(tǒng),其特征在于,所述匯聚設備還用于周期性交互鏈路捆綁組信息,當確定的主鏈路捆綁組與前次確定的主鏈路捆綁組不一致時,執(zhí)行主備鏈路捆綁組的倒換。
【專利摘要】本發(fā)明一種鏈路捆綁方法及系統(tǒng),該方法包括:為接入設備分配至少兩個匯聚設備;接入設備與匯聚設備建立鏈路捆綁組;匯聚設備交互鏈路捆綁組信息,根據鏈路捆綁組信息確定主鏈路捆綁組及備鏈路捆綁組。通過本發(fā)明的實施,為同一接入設備分配多個匯聚設備,分別鏈路捆綁組,使得接入設備可以通過多個鏈路捆綁組/匯聚設備與網絡服務器連接,并且根據鏈路捆綁組信息來確定主備鏈路捆綁組,正常情況下,接入設備通過主鏈路捆綁組完成數據轉發(fā),當主鏈路捆綁組或者所連接的匯聚設備故障時,通過主備倒換完成鏈路捆綁組的倒換,這樣接入設備就可以保持業(yè)務的正常運行,解決了現有技術存在的當鏈路捆綁組/匯聚設備故障所導致業(yè)務中斷的問題。
【IPC分類】H04L12/24
【公開號】CN105703922
【申請?zhí)枴?br>【發(fā)明人】林潔, 劉園園
【申請人】中興通訊股份有限公司
【公開日】2016年6月22日
【申請日】2014年11月24日